English
Language : 

TNETA1570 Datasheet, PDF (19/68 Pages) Texas Instruments – ATM SEGMENTATION AND REASSEMBLY DEVICE WITH INTEGRATED 64-BIT PCI-HOST INTERFACE
TNETA1570
ATM SEGMENTATION AND REASSEMBLY DEVICE
WITH INTEGRATED 64ĆBIT PCIĆHOST INTERFACE
SDNS033B − JUNE 1995 − REVISED MAY 1996
PRINCIPLES OF OPERATION
Table of Contents
Functional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 19
Segmentation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26
Reassembly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 35
Cell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 46
Host Interface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 49
Internal Registers and Counters . . . . . . . . . . . . . . . . . . . . . . . . . . . . 58
Control-Memory Maps .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 66
functional overview
The function of the TNETA1570 is centered around the entries in the TX DMA state table for segmentation and
the RX DMA state table for reassembly. The entries in the tables hold information regarding what type of data
to process, where to find it or store it, and the current status of the segmentation/reassembly process for the
entry.
For segmentation, the scheduler table is used to select the next entry in the TX DMA state table for processing.
For reassembly, the VPI and VCI fields of the incoming ATM cell are decoded using the VPI/VCI DMA pointer
table to locate the entry in the RX DMA state table for processing.
The data interface to the host is the 32-bit/64-bit PCI-bus interface. The interface to the ATM layer is the UTOPIA
interface.
functional block diagram
PCI-Bus
Interface
Segmentation
Reassembly
UTOPIA
Interface
UTOPIA Transmit
PCI Bus
Control-
Memory
Interface
and
Arbitration
Segmentation
Scheduler
Reassembly
Time Out
JTAG
Reassembly
Reassembly
UTOPIA
Interface
UTOPIA Receive
Control Memory
Other Data
Payload Data
The TNETA1570 can be configured to transmit and receive either AAL5 or transparent-AAL packets. The
segmentation and reassembly of AAL5 packets is performed in accordance with ITU-T specifications I.361 and
I.363 (11/93 update). The protocol used to segment and reassemble AAL5 packets is well specified in the ITU-T
documents. The protocols for segmenting and reassembling a transparent-AAL packet is not specified by any
known standards body; therefore, there is no official sanction for a transparent AAL and no interoperability
specification exists. However, a transparent AAL provides a convenient method for transporting proprietary
control and data information or data traffic that does not fit well in a currently defined AAL (i.e., voice/video
traffic).
NOTE: The terms transmit and segmentation are both used to describe the segmentation operation and the terms receive and reassemble are
both used to describe the reassembly operation in this document.
• POST OFFICE BOX 655303 DALLAS, TEXAS 75265
• POST OFFICE BOX 1443 HOUSTON, TEXAS 77251−1443
19